Finance Review Summary — Orelline Product Line Pricing

For the incoming director: margins on the Orelline line have slipped four points since the spring reprice. Entry SKU is underpriced versus cost inflation; premium SKU is fine. Recommendation: raise entry pricing 6% in two steps, hold premium, and sunset the mid-tier bundle that cannibalises both. Channel partners were consulted; pushback was mild. Volume risk is modelled at under 3%. Board sign-off expected this cycle. The confidential pricing roadmap for next year appears below.

management briefing: The renewal with Zoraelax Group closes at $10 million a year, 15 percent below the last contract. Project Ralael slips by six weeks because of the audit delay.

# This fixture reproduces the N+1 regression we patched in Quillbrook's
# GraphQL resolver layer. Before release 4.2, each `orderLine` field issued
# a separate database call; the new batching loader collapses these into
# one query per request. Please verify the fixture passes against staging
# before sign-off. The staging gateway authenticates with the token below.

bearer token for tawig-bahif: eyJhbGciOiJIUzI1NiIsInR5cCI6IkpXVCJ9.eyJzdWIiOiIo-yiO33jvEIn0.T9qLInSAqhTN

## Session Handling in the Formula Sandbox

User-supplied formulas in Calquill execute inside the Wrenbox sandbox, which strips ambient credentials before evaluation. Each session receives a scoped capability set; formulas cannot open sockets or read host environment variables. Reviewers should verify that sandbox sessions expire after ninety seconds of inactivity and that escalation attempts are logged to the Tarnwell audit stream. Sandbox sessions authenticate to the audit stream with the bearer token below.

login token, yawig-kagaf: eyJhbGciOiJIUzI1NiIsInR5cCI6IkpXVCJ9.eyJzdWIiOiIlAlfV7MEnpIn0.t7OupPTrg_dn